About this course

In today's world, there is a growing demand for professionals who can leverage geospatial technology to improve food sustainability practices. This course is specifically designed to meet that demand, providing learners with hands-on experience in using geospatial tools and techniques to analyze and solve real-world food sustainability challenges. Throughout the course, learners will gain practical experience in remote sensing, geographic information systems (GIS), and global positioning systems (GPS). They will also learn how to apply these tools to food sustainability issues such as crop yield analysis, precision agriculture, and land use planning. Upon completion of the course, learners will be prepared to take on leadership roles in food sustainability and related industries. They will have the skills and knowledge necessary to drive innovation, improve food sustainability practices, and make a positive impact on the world.

Career path

Career Roles in Geospatial Technology for Food Sustainability (UK) Description
Precision Agriculture Specialist Utilizing geospatial data and GIS for optimizing farm management, improving crop yields, and promoting sustainable practices.
Food Supply Chain Analyst Analyzing geospatial data to enhance the efficiency and sustainability of food supply chains, minimizing waste and ensuring food security.
Environmental Monitoring Specialist Employing remote sensing and GIS technologies to monitor environmental factors impacting food production and promoting sustainable land management.
Geographic Information Systems (GIS) Manager Overseeing geospatial data management, analysis, and implementation within food sustainability initiatives. Requires strong leadership and GIS expertise.
Sustainable Food Systems Consultant Advising organizations on integrating geospatial technologies into sustainable food systems, implementing best practices and promoting responsible resource management.
